Pengaruh Suhu Dan Waktu Pengeringan Terhadap Mutu Rumput Laut Kering

Abstract: Indonesia sebagai salah satu penghasil rumput laut Eucheuma cottoni terbesar di Dunia maka di perlukan pengembanagn dalam penaganan hasil dari rumput laut yang dihasilkan salah satunya adalah tahap pengeringan rumput laut. Kandungan rumput laut merupakan salah satu bagian yang harus diperhatikan dalam pemrosesesan rumput laut. Mengingat manfaat rumput laut yang luas dalam industri kosmetik, pangan dan obat-obatan.Hasil penelitian ini bertujuan untuk menngetahui waktu dan suhu operasi dalam proses pengeringan s… Show more

“…In the experiment using the oven dryer the optimum time of seaweed drying at 4 hours with a temperature of 650C where the moisture content obtained is 0.1608 kg water / kg RL, this indicates there is still a lot of water content in seaweed, so it takes a long time by increasing operating temperature [3]. The maximum level of dryness of this ATC product is 15% water content according to SNI 8170: 2015 Alkali treated Seaweed Chips.…”

“…The experimental results show conformity with the literature, which states that a considerable decrease in drying rate at the beginning of drying is due to the high-water content of taro which makes it easy to evaporate. Inversely proportional to the end of drying, namely, the water content in the material is getting less, which causes the water content to be challenging to evaporate so that the drying rate is slower [38] . Based on the results of the ANOVA, it was obtained that different times can reduce the drying rate significantly.…”
